class FuzzyCMeans:
    def __init__(self, n_clusters, initial_centers, data, max_iter=250, m=2, error=1e-5):
        assert m > 1
        #assert initial_centers.shape[0] == n_clusters
        self.U = None
        self.centers = initial_centers
        self.max_iter = max_iter
        self.m = m
        self.error = error
        self.data = data

    def membership(self, data, centers):
        U_temp = cdist(data, centers, 'euclidean')
        U_temp = numpy.power(U_temp, 2/(self.m - 1))
        denominator_ = U_temp.reshape(
            (data.shape[0], 1, -1)).repeat(U_temp.shape[-1], axis=1)
        denominator_ = U_temp[:, :, numpy.newaxis] / denominator_
        return 1 / denominator_.sum(2)
